Shig's first round was difficult and clean.. But it takes more than that to beat Menno. The thing is, after bboying for years, seeing tons of bboys, and creating your own sets, you'll know that a lot of the moves that Shig did in his first round are very common. Airchairs, halos, airflares, etc. With Menno, more than half of the moves in his sets don't have names because he invented them. They're his trademark movements and nobody else does them (unless they're biting him), his style and sets are unlike anyone else's in the world, and that is a very very difficult thing to do that I don't think a lot of newer bboys understand. When the veteran bboys see Menno it's immediately "Whoa this is a unique style and movement" as opposed to seeing Shig and thinking "ok airchair, sixstep, halo, freeze," etc. But don't get me wrong Shig definitely has his moments. I think if he had done the set that he did against Danny Dan here he might've had a chance because it had far more trademark moves. But like I said, difficult and clean moves just won't cut it at the top. Just my opinion, as someone that danced from 1999 to 2009, and kept watching bboying ever since.
